Gaura Population - Lakhisarai, Bihar

Gaura is a large village located in Halsi Block of Lakhisarai district, Bihar with total 371 families residing. The Gaura village has population of 2304 of which 1213 are males while 1091 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Gaura village population of children with age 0-6 is 502 which makes up 21.79 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Gaura village is 899 which is lower than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Gaura as per census is 931, lower than Bihar average of 935.

Gaura village has lower liter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Gaura village was 50.78 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Gaura Male literacy stands at 61.59 % while female literacy rate was 38.63 %.

Caste Factor

Gaura village of Lakhisarai has substantial population of Schedule Caste.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 28.43 % of total population in Gaura village. The village Gaura curr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Gaura village out of total population, 647 were engaged in work activities. 94.13 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 5.87 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 647 workers engaged in Main Work, 329 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 260 were Agricultural labourer.
